Map location of
AT&T, New Boston, OH, USA

New Boston, Ohio, United States

Categories

Visit the AT&T retail store in New Boston, Ohio for all your technology needs. Shop for the latest devices and accessories from the trusted AT&T brand.


Points of Interest near AT&T

Additional information

  • Brand : AT&T